Understanding the Interaction Between Probiotics and Semaglutide To understand why you might want to combine these two, it is helpful to look at how semaglutide works in the body
Semaglutide activates GLP-1 receptors throughout the gastrointestinal tract, which slows gastric emptying and can trigger bloating, gas, and abdominal fullness in the first 24 weeks of treatment
